Viewing parcel posted shipments
SmartTurn shipments in status Closed or Committed may be in one of three states with respect to parcel posting:
A SmartTurn shipment with Parcel Post Status of...
|
...means that...
|
...and the shipment will appear in...
|
Not Posted
|
the shipment has not been parcel posted in SmartTurn
|
Fulfillment>View Shipments
|
In Progress
|
the shipment has been parcel posted from SmartTurn using a third party application. The parcel post information has been sent from SmartTurn to the third party application
|
Fulfillment>View Shipments
|
Posted
|
the shipment has been parcel posted in SmartTurn in one of two ways:
- manually - the user has clicked OK from the Parcel Post screen and saved the information entered
- using a third party application - the parcel post information has been sent from SmartTurn to the third party application, ShipRush. The user has completed entering information in the ShipRush application and clicked "Ship." The parcel post information has been sent from ShipRush back to SmartTurn
|
Fulfillment>View Shipments
AND
Fulfillment>View Parcel Posts
|
To view shipments that have been parcel posted:
- Select Fulfillment>View Parcel Posts. A list of shipments that have been parcel posted appears. (All the shipments have Status of
Closed or Committed, and have Parcel Post Status of Posted.) If needed, you can filter or sort the list.If you parcel post shipments frequently, consider customizing the Fulfillment>View Shipments screen to display the Parcel Post Status in a separate column. See Customizing a page for more information.
- To view a specific shipment, double-click the record, or highlight the record and click
View. The shipment displays. General shipment information is up above, including a new Parcel Post tab with parcel post information such as Parcel Carrier, Total Estimated Charges, and Tracking #. A list of shipment items is below.
To export shipments that have been parcel posted:
- Select Fulfillment>View Parcel Posts. A list of shipments that have been parcel posted appears. (All the shipments have Status of
Closed or Committed, and have Parcel Post Status of Posted.) - Sort or filter your list to isolate the group of records you want to export. You can also export the entire list, unfiltered, if you want. You can export up to 10,000 records.
- Click
Export from the toolbar. The Export pop-up appears. Important: Do not close this pop-up. Closing the pop-up cancels your request for exported data. If needed, you can minimize the Export pop-up.
- Optionally, continue working in SmartTurn while your export request is being processed.
Note: You can only create one export request at a time. However, you can continue with all of your other work in SmartTurn.
- When the export is complete, a dialog opens asking you if you want to open or save the file.
- Select Save. Save the file to a directory on your machine.
- A spreadsheet appears with the data you selected. SmartTurn exports many attributes of your data, not just the columns you see in the list view.
- At this time, it is safe to close your Export pop-up. Select Close if the pop-up does not automatically close once your export is complete.
